Understanding UML: The Developer's Guide (The Morgan Kaufmann Series in Software Engineering and Programming) Review

Understanding UML: The Developer's Guide (The Morgan Kaufmann Series in Software Engineering and Programming)
Average Reviews:

(More customer reviews)
Are you looking to buy Understanding UML: The Developer's Guide (The Morgan Kaufmann Series in Software Engineering and Programming)? Here is the right place to find the great deals. we can offer discounts of up to 90% on Understanding UML: The Developer's Guide (The Morgan Kaufmann Series in Software Engineering and Programming). Check out the link below:

>> Click Here to See Compare Prices and Get the Best Offers

Understanding UML: The Developer's Guide (The Morgan Kaufmann Series in Software Engineering and Programming) ReviewWhile this book goes further than most other OO design books I've read, it still falls well short of answering the elusive question - How the hell do I apply all this to my real life large scale applications? Most authors conveniently ignore the very existence of the GUI and focus on the easy part - the business classes. At least this books acknowledges the role of infrastructure classes and does give a few tips on when to introduce infrastructure classes in the analysis/design process. Fact is, in most business applications over 60% of the coding and maintenance effort is spent on the GUI and infrastructure (the How-To of an application). The authors too seems to agree that the nuts-and-bolt design takes up the most time in OO development process. In spite of this, less than 10% of the book is devoted to design. In fact, fleshing out the detailed design is left to the reader. The book does not even provide a complete class diagram for the simple example application.
Surprisingly, the authors suggest that developing the user interface could be done outside UML design! That means that the painstakingly developed models are useless when it comes to generating code! If I can't model all the classes in my application, round-trip engineering, as promised by many a UML tool vendors, becomes a pipe dream and the whole UML iterative development methodology falls flat on it's face. Very disappointing.Understanding UML: The Developer's Guide (The Morgan Kaufmann Series in Software Engineering and Programming) Overview

Want to learn more information about Understanding UML: The Developer's Guide (The Morgan Kaufmann Series in Software Engineering and Programming)?

>> Click Here to See All Customer Reviews & Ratings Now

0 comments:

Post a Comment